Latest Patents
Ryan Michaud holds a patent titled "Method for monitoring an electromagnetic actuator type apparatus." This patent outlines a comprehensive monitoring method for equipment that includes a three-phase electric motor. The method involves measuring three-phase currents, projecting them into a Park reference frame, and utilizing advanced techniques such as empirical mode decomposition and blind source separation. The process allows for the automatic selection of source components sensitive to specific defects, leading to the construction of virtual defect signals and the extraction of representative signatures for those defects.
